Austine Umudu is a seasoned environmental engineer and technical professional with an extensive career spanning quality assurance, dam construction and inspection, environmental compliance, and infrastructure development across Australia and Africa. As Managing Director of Glanville Group Pty Ltd, he provides the technical vision, engineering discipline, and operational leadership that underpins the Group's reputation for excellence.
Austine brings a rare combination of formal environmental engineering credentials and hands-on project experience in some of the most technically demanding environments in the infrastructure and resources sectors. His career has seen him lead and contribute to large-scale dam construction projects, conducting detailed structural and geotechnical inspections that have directly informed critical safety decisions. His expertise extends to the design and implementation of quality assurance systems for major civil infrastructure projects — work that requires not only technical precision but the ability to communicate complex findings clearly to both technical and executive audiences.
In the realm of environmental engineering, Austine has managed environmental impact assessments, compliance monitoring programmes, and regulatory liaison processes — equipping him with a comprehensive understanding of how infrastructure development intersects with environmental obligations. This knowledge informs the Group's approach to responsible, sustainable project delivery.
"Engineering is ultimately about responsibility — responsibility to the people who will use the structures we build, to the communities who live alongside them, and to the environment we work within. At Glanville Group, we carry that responsibility into every project, every inspection, and every client relationship." - Austine Umudu, Managing Director
Emmanuella Umunnakwe is a highly accomplished business administrator, corporate affairs leader, and change management specialist whose career has been defined by her ability to bring structure, clarity, and human-centred leadership to complex organisational challenges. As Director of Corporate Affairs & Strategy at Glanville Group, she provides the governance, people management, strategic consulting, and change leadership capability that enables the Group's businesses and its clients to grow and evolve with confidence.
Emmanuella's career spans the full organisational lifecycle — from the early-stage structuring and governance of new businesses through to the complex people dynamics of mature organisations navigating transformation. Her background includes senior HR management roles, where she led human resources functions through periods of significant organisational change, embedding new performance frameworks, managing employee relations in challenging environments, and building HR capability from the ground up.
Her specialisation in change management has been applied across corporate restructuring programmes, technology implementations, culture change initiatives, and merger integration processes. She brings both the methodological rigour of internationally recognised change management frameworks and the interpersonal intelligence to know when the human element requires more attention than the process. Her experience in corporate affairs encompasses board governance support, company secretarial functions, regulatory compliance, and strategic stakeholder engagement.
"Organisations don't change — people do. And people change when they understand the 'why', trust the leadership, and feel genuinely supported through the journey. Every change programme I lead begins with listening, and ends with people who own the new reality." - Emmanuella Umunnakwe, Director of Corporate Affairs & Strategy
